General Dynamics Balance Sheet Health

Financial Health criteria checks 6/6

General Dynamics has a total shareholder equity of $26.1B and total debt of $8.0B, which brings its debt-to-equity ratio to 30.7%. Its total assets and total liabilities are $59.0B and $33.0B respectively. General Dynamics's EBIT is $5.6B making its interest coverage ratio 19. It has cash and short-term investments of $3.7B.

Financial Position Analysis

Short Term Liabilities: GD's short term assets ($26.1B) exceed its short term liabilities ($18.8B).

Long Term Liabilities: GD's short term assets ($26.1B) exceed its long term liabilities ($14.1B).


Debt to Equity History and Analysis

Debt Level: GD's net debt to equity ratio (16.7%) is considered satisfactory.

Reducing Debt: GD's debt to equity ratio has reduced from 86% to 30.7% over the past 5 years.

Debt Coverage: GD's debt is well covered by operating cash flow (92.5%).

Interest Coverage: GD's interest payments on its debt are well covered by EBIT (19x coverage).
